Anyone up for a vampire cookie? Yeah, I know this is a little gooey-gory, but hey, I just had to make them anyway. These are butter cookies, that I confess I made from a mix. I used Strawberry jam (with a little extra red food coloring) for the bite marks.
Okay, these fortune cookies were my favorite to make. I did not actually make the cookies, BUT I did have to microwave each of them for 30 seconds to soften them. After that I was able to take out the original fortune and add in a quote from either Jacob or Edward from the first two books. It was so fun to go back and reread quotes from the books.
